Marketing Assistant - London

Are you a creative mind with an eye for detail? Passionate about presentation, a lover of language and, ideally, a wine enthusiast? Then you could just be the Marketing Assistant we’re looking for! We want a tech-savvy marketeer who can help execute and improve our digital offerings, from email campaigns to collections on our website; we’re building a new team of eager and dedicated professionals to ramp up FINE+RARE’s Brand output, and there’s great opportunity for leaving your mark on the company.

The Marketing Assistant will support the Brand team with responsibility for content management of our global websites, implementation of offer and editorial email campaigns, social media management and general website upkeep in creating and executing a distinct visual identity for FINE+RARE on all touchpoints.

As a key member of the Brand team, you will:

• Assist with the maintenance of our global websites including site-wide content updates, image uploads in the catalogue and site merchandising.

• Create and optimise email templates using HubSpot for offers and weekly newsletters.

• Support the planning, development and updating of social content.

• Review the Instagram account’s tagged posts and stories for relevant reposting.

• Assist with copywriting and proofing for web, Instagram captions, newsletters, and other forms of brand communications.

• Ensure the Imagery archive is properly organised, updated and backed up.

• Proactively work on content creation (photography, videography) and document tastings, private client dinners, winery visits etc.

• Monitor key competitors and other relevant luxury brand sectors to challenge F+R’s thinking and approach.

PERSON SPECIFICATION

• Bachelor’s degree in a marketing-related field.

• Prior experience in a similar marketing role with a passion for luxury brands.

• Excellent English verbal and written communication skills.

• Advanced competencies in core Adobe CS, Figma and MS Office software.

• Experience scheduling content on social media (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n etc.).

• Experience updating images and content on websites.

• Proven communication skills and ability to liaise effectively with multiple stakeholders.

• Good time management and prioritisation skills, with the 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ced environment.

• A keen eye for detail.

• Ability to interpret and consistently apply brand guidelines.

• Good understanding of a range of print and online design processes.

• Tech-savvy with a willingness to learn and adapt to new platforms quickly.

• An interest in fine wine and spirits.
